    Connecting the solar panel to the lithium generator involves several straightforward steps. Follow this master execution plan to ensure a successful installation.

    1. Mount the Solar Panel
      Securely install the solar panel on a stable surface using the mounting hardware. Ensure it is angled correctly for optimal sunlight exposure.

    2. Install the Charge Controller
      Connect the charge controller to the solar panel. This device will manage the energy flow to the lithium generator.

    3. Connect Cables
      Use appropriate gauge cables to connect the solar panel to the charge controller and then to the lithium generator. Ensure all connections are tight and secure.

    4. Test the System
      After all connections are made, check the system to ensure it is functioning correctly. Monitor the charge levels on the lithium generator.

    Understanding the costs associated with this project is essential for effective budgeting. Here’s a breakdown of potential expenses:

    Item Estimated Cost
    Solar Panel $100 – $300
    Lithium Generator $200 – $800
    Charge Controller $50 – $150
    Cables and Connectors $20 – $50
    Mounting Hardware $30 – $100

    Avoiding common pitfalls can lead to a smoother installation process. Here are frequent mistakes to watch out for:

    • Using Incorrect Cables: Ensure the wire gauge matches the current requirements to prevent overheating.

    • Ignoring Manual Instructions: Always refer to the manuals for specific connection instructions and safety warnings.

    • Poor Panel Placement: Avoid shaded areas that can reduce solar efficiency. Aim for direct sunlight.

    • Neglecting Maintenance: Regularly clean the solar panel to maximize efficiency and inspect connections for wear.
